LEMIRE: "Meanwhile, transgender swimmers now are restricted from competing in elite women’s competitions. Swimming’s world governing body announced yesterday it voted to adopt the new policy, which takes effect immediately, begins today. It requires transgender swimmers to have completed their transition by the age of 12, and to remain below a level of circulating testosterone in order to compete in women’s events.”
